Committee D12 on Soaps and Other Detergents

Staff Manager: David Lee

ASTM Committee D12 on Soaps and Other Detergents was formed in 1936. D12 meets once a year, usually in October, with about 15 members attending one day of technical meetings. The Committee, with a membership of 71, currently has jurisdiction of 40 standards, published in the Annual Book of ASTM Standards, Volume 15.04. D12 has 6 technical subcommittees that maintain jurisdiction over these standards. These standards have and continue to play a preeminent role in all aspects important to the industry including: composition, sampling, properties, classification, nomenclature, analysis, and quality assurance.
